Cisco Umbrella and Akamai Edge DNS are leading solutions in cloud-delivered security and global DNS services, respectively. Cisco Umbrella holds a competitive edge in security and ease of deployment, while Akamai Edge DNS excels in global performance due to its extensive infrastructure.
Features: Cisco Umbrella offers advanced threat protection, content filtering, and secure internet access, making it strong in security and malware protection. Akamai Edge DNS is valued for its global distribution, scalability, and high availability, ensuring rapid and reliable DNS services.
Room for Improvement: Cisco Umbrella can enhance scalability in larger global infrastructures, improve detailed analytics and reporting features, and expand integration with non-Cisco products. Akamai Edge DNS could boost threat intelligence capabilities, simplify initial setup processes, and provide better integration with security products.
Ease of Deployment and Customer Service: Cisco Umbrella provides straightforward cloud setup with integrated security services for quick deployment, though it may require more flexible customization options. Akamai Edge DNS involves a more complex setup due to its large-scale infrastructure but offers extensive support to assist with complex DNS configurations.
Pricing and ROI: Cisco Umbrella presents straightforward pricing and compelling ROI for businesses focused on comprehensive security, while Akamai Edge DNS requires higher upfront investments yet delivers excellent ROI for top-tier DNS services due to its performance and coverage.

Cisco Umbrella delivers rapid DNS security with over 30,000 customers, providing outstanding threat protection and handling more than 600 billion requests daily. It's recognized for high threat efficacy in the SSE domain and integrates elements like SWG, ZTNA, CASB, and more.
Cisco Umbrella is renowned for its effective DNS-layer security against ransomware and phishing. It offers flexible content filtering and integrates seamlessly with existing networks while providing single-pane-of-glass management for centralized monitoring. Its robust threat intelligence and customizable policies are central to its appeal. Users highlight room for improvement in areas like WHOIS data inclusion, malware enhancement, and reporting analytics. Integration with other threat feeds and better client support are requested for more comprehensive coverage.

Industries implement Cisco Umbrella primarily for DNS-level security, web filtering, and protecting remote employees. It strengthens cybersecurity frameworks by blocking malware and avoiding access to harmful sites. The tool is widely integrated with Active Directory and Cisco Meraki, providing consistent internet security for employees.
